Smudging Air

Paintings in this series were created between 1996 and 2018. Predominantly monochromatic, these paintings feature the wide adaptability range of ink as it can be diluted, saturated, contained and overflow. As a medium, ink is always reacting to the absorption ability of its environment. Similar to humans, we shape our environments as much as our environments shape us. The series title refers to smudging air, an indigenous purification ritual emulated across the world, from churches to temples to modern aromatherapy all straddling a fine line between science, spirituality and myth. Like Rorschach inkblots and Feynman fractals, the pieces explore how order and chaos meet in the mind of the beholder, while smoke rises as spirit-like forms.
